    Millhouse is definitely a highroll hero, but a strong candidate to top 4. Like any heroes, starting with a token makes huge difference.

    If I start with a token minion, I sell the token next turn to tier up so that I can buy 2 next turn. You lose that 2nd round almost every time, but you don't float any gold and it justifies itself later.

    Well, if I don't start with token, I end up buying minions for 2-3 turns before tier up. Your tier 1 minions barely compete with Tier 2-3 minions unless you go demon. These games are usually tough, but you can catch up if you get to Tier 3 right after Tier 2.

    He gets played differently that any other heroes, that makes you think out of the box. It is a refreshing experience for sure.

    "It costs 0" does not has the same meaning as "Reduce its cost to 0". One fixes the cost to 0, thus cannot be changed again; while other just reduces it and can be changed.
